Competition Landscape
Bitcoin ERC20 BTC operates in a competitive space featuring several similar assets such as WBTC (Wrapped Bitcoin), renBTC, and tBTC. Its competitive edge depends on factors like security protocols, liquidity, ease of use, and integration capabilities. While WBTC dominates the market with widespread adoption and partnered ecosystem support, Bitcoin ERC20 BTC strives to differentiate through improved interoperability, lower fees, and enhanced smart contract functionality. The success of such tokens hinges on community trust, liquidity pools, and broad acceptance within DeFi frameworks.

Potential Risks and Challenges
Despite its advantages, investing in or using Bitcoin ERC20 BTC involves certain risks. Market volatility remains a fundamental concern; the value can fluctuate significantly based on market sentiment. Risks related to smart contract vulnerabilities, custody issues, and potential liquidity shortages also prevail. Moreover, regulatory uncertainties surrounding tokenized assets and wrapped tokens often pose challenges for adoption. Consumers and developers must prioritize security audits, reputable custodians, and compliance considerations to mitigate these risks effectively.
